During the early to mid-1400s the Convento’s importance continued under the stewardship of Henry the Navigator. A driving force behind Portugal’s Age of Discovery, Henry had a rectangular nave built onto the circular chapel. On its own the nave might have been quite impressive, but compared to the adjoining chapel the interior of the nave is almost boringly plain. However it is the exterior of the nave that commands attention. Completed during the reign of King Manuel I in the early 1500s, the ornate exterior stonework is a stellar example of Manueline style. The nave features the famous chapter house window by architect Diogo de Arruda.
